What are the top historical sites and other places in Victoria?
Victoria is notable for landmarks like The Citadel, St John's Demi-Bastion and Old Prison. Cultural venues include Gozo Nature Museum and Il Hagar - Heart of Gozo Museum. A couple of additional sights to add to your itinerary are St. George's Basilica and Villa Rundle Gardens.
What is a historic hotel like in Victoria?
Guests who choose a historic hotel can spend a night or two in a place that has an officially recognised historic designation. A castle, a palace or even a pub or an old police station can be turned into a historic hotel provided that it has special significance. Traditional architecture and period features are typically preserved in the guestrooms or communal spaces of these historic hotels in Victoria, giving a real sense of character.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, wheareas the term "histor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S. but over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and building of a historic hotel tends to be the most important aspect. For a heritage hotel, it's often the cultural value and how it shaped the community.
